We live in a log cabin and it is a lot of fun trying to come up with new decorating ideas that enhance the rustic charm of the cabin. Here is an idea for curtains that do not overwhelm a small room.
This could not be more simple, as it does not require sewing. Just hang a simple curtain rod and drape a throw rug over it! These rugs remind me of navajo blankets. I found them at IKEA of all places for $3.99 each. Here’s the link where you can purchase them online.
Some variations could include draping a light bedspread or some colorful sheets over the rod — you might keep this in mind as you determine the size of your rod and how much of an extension you allow past the window.
